> Store INodeId instead of the INodeFile object in BlockInfoContiguous

> Currently the namespace and the block manager are tightly coupled together.
> There are two couplings in terms of implementation:
> 1. The {{BlockInfoContiguous}} stores a reference of the {{INodeFile}} that
> owns the block, so that the block manager can look up the corresponding file
> when replicating blocks, recovering from pipeline failures, etc.
> 1. The {{INodeFile}} stores {{BlockInfoContiguous}} objects that the file
> owns.
> Decoupling the namespace and the block manager allows the BM to be separated
> out from the Java heap or even as a standalone process. This jira proposes to
> remove the first coupling by storing the id of the inode instead of the
> object reference of {{INodeFile}} in the {{BlockInfoContiguous}} class.
